Cosplay Feature: Variable's Aeris!


I apologize that it's taken me this long to feature the absolutely gorgeous Variable for you all again. Last time around was with her practically perfect (in my opinion) Power Girl. This time around however, she created an incredible Aeris Gainsborough from the iconic Final Fantasy 7. For the last remaining Cetra, Variable created the long pink dress and the jacket that's over it. The jacket itself is is of a darker shade of pink/mixed in with some red. Breast pockets and buttons are all throughout it. On her wrists, Variable has some metal cuffs and another can be seen on an end sleeve to the jacket. What's cool about this cuff is that there are small dots around it. My guess would be that it references the Materia slots that are a part of the game's equipment.

For Aeris' iconic hairstyle, Variable ordered a deep brown wig and styled it as such. Bangs are seen on either side and the back has the long ponytail all tied up thanks to the pink bow. The front of the wig has this very circular shape to it as well. A thin black strip is wrapped around her neck and has quite the extravagant bow. The long pink gown is also buttoned up until the bottom area near her legs so that well...she can walk easily!

The photos are perfectly fitting for Aeris, character-wise. The setting is near a pool but the rocks and small trees nearby make it very earthy. Plus, Variable looks absolutely innocent with her facial expressions and again, I truly love that!
